Analysis

In 2018, netherlands (kingdom of the) — paper and paperboard, excluding in Austria stood at 77,615 1000 USD.

That represents a change of up 6.9% on the previous year and down 55.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, netherlands (kingdom of the) — paper and paperboard, excluding in Austria peaked at 242,284 1000 USD in 2002 and was at its lowest, 64,678 1000 USD, in 2015.

Austria ranks 7th of 70 countries on this measure, in the top 10%.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 22 years of available data.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
